Description: Put.io is a file hosting service that offers cloud storage and file sharing functionality. It allows users to upload, store, and share files securely as well as stream video, music, and other media from the cloud.

Description: ByteBX is an open-source billing and invoicing software designed for small to medium sized businesses. It allows creating professional invoices, tracking payments and expenses, managing clients and products, and generating various financial reports.
